    Can I change a cell and cause an automatic change in other cells

    Is there a function or formula that will allow me to make a change in one
    cell on the work sheet and the program will automatically change one or more
    designated cells with that same change?

    Simply refer to that cell in your other "designated" cells, as such:

    If A1 is your base cell, in another cell enter =A1

    When you change the value in A1, it will change in your other cell to show what is in A1

    You could perform math functions as such: =25-A1
    If you enter 10 in A1, your cell will show 15
    change A1 to 20 and your cell will now show 5
